In this collection of essays, renowned poet and scholar Thomas Herbert Warren offers a comprehensive exploration of poetry from ancient to modern times. He examines the work of famous poets such as Homer, Dante, Shakespeare, and Milton, while also exploring the work of lesser-known poets and the evolution of poetic form and style over the centuries. Written with erudition and passion, this book is an essential addition to any poetry lover's collection.
